However, the malware's dynamic changed in October 2022. Facing numerous fraudulent copies and scammers impersonating him in hacking forums, the developer decided to release the source code of his CypherRat (SpyNote.C) project on GitHub. This decision effectively "open-sourced" a sophisticated, multi-purpose malware that combined the spying capabilities of a RAT with the account theft features of a banking trojan. This leak explains why terms like "spynote 6.5 github" remain so prevalent; they are a popular search for the builder tools and source code that emerged from this leak. Unlike legitimate remote administration tools used by IT departments, SpyNote operates covertly. It hides its application icon, bypasses standard system warnings, and establishes a persistent connection to a Command and Control (C2) server managed by the attacker. SpyNote 6.5 is a malware construction kit or "builder." It generates a malicious Android Application Package (APK) file. Attackers trick victims into installing this APK through phishing, fake app stores, or social engineering.
